Full Story Of The Temple Town – Ayodhya In Picture

The construction of Ram Temple in Ayodhya begins today. Prime Minister Narendra Modi attended the Bhoomi Pujan ceremony and lay the foundation brick. At least 170 eminent guests were invited for the foundation stone-laying ceremony of the Ram temple in Ayodhya.

The site of the Ram Temple had been disputed for decades until last year when the Supreme Court in November awarded a Hindu group, the ownership of the site. Here’s a the story of the temple town of Ayodhya, in pictures:

5th Century BCE

According to the poet Valmiki, who wrote the ancient Sanskrit epic Ramayana, Ayodhya is the birthplace of Dasaratha’s son Ram.

1528

Babri Masjid is constructed in Ayodhya by Mughal emperor Babur.

1853

First recorded instance of religious violence near the site.

1949

Ram & Sita idols placed at the site. The government declares the site disputed.

1984

Hindus form a committee to build a temple on the site.

1986

VHP (Vishwa Hindu Parishad) lays the foundation for the Ram temple.

1990

BJP supremo LK Advani undertakes ‘Rath Yatra.’

1991

BJP comes to power in Uttar Pradesh.

December 6, 1992

Babri Masjid is demolished.

1992

Liberhan Commission is formed.
